Chelsea Considering Jhon Duran Move Amid Aston Villa Transfer Twist
Chelsea are exploring a potential deal to sign Aston Villa striker Jhon Duran, with Axel Disasi potentially heading in the opposite direction.

Chelsea’s January transfer activity could take a new direction as Aston Villa’s Jhon Duran becomes a viable target. With Villa needing defensive reinforcements following injuries to Tyrone Mings and Pau Torres, the situation presents an opportunity for Chelsea to negotiate a deal. Talks could involve Axel Disasi joining Villa, while Duran’s move would help bolster Chelsea's attacking options amid Nicolas Jackson’s struggles.
- Chelsea’s Striker Hunt: With Nicolas Jackson struggling for consistency, Chelsea is considering Duran as a solution to strengthen their attack.
- Villa’s Defensive Crisis: Aston Villa is in dire need of defensive options, creating an opportunity for a player exchange involving Axel Disasi.
- Potential Swap Deal: While not a direct swap, negotiations could see Chelsea and Villa working out a deal that benefits both clubs.
- Duran’s Situation: The Colombian international has played second-fiddle to Ollie Watkins at Villa, potentially making him open to a move for more game time.
- Financial Feasibility: Chelsea have the financial capacity to make the deal happen, possibly offsetting costs with a loan fee or conditions tied to the Disasi deal.
